Understanding Rowing Machines
What is a Rowing Machine?
A rowing machine is a stationary exercise equipment designed to mimic the motion of rowing a boat. It offers a full-body workout, engaging your upper body, lower body, and core muscles. Rowing machines are known for their low-impact nature, making them suitable for individuals of all fitness levels, including those recovering from injuries.
Types of Rowing Machines
- Air Rower: These machines use air resistance, which increases as you row harder. They are quiet, smooth, and provide a natural rowing feel.
- Water Rower: Water rowers use the resistance of water, offering a realistic rowing experience. They are quieter than air rowers and provide a smooth, consistent resistance.
- Magnetic Rower: Magnetic rowers use magnetic resistance, which is adjustable and provides a quiet workout. They are compact and easy to store.
- Hydraulic Rower: These machines use hydraulic pistons to create resistance. They are budget-friendly and require minimal maintenance.
Honest Reviews
Air Rower: Concept2 Model D
The Concept2 Model D is a top choice among rowers and fitness enthusiasts. It offers a commercial-grade build, a comfortable seat, and a sturdy frame. The air resistance system provides a smooth and consistent workout, and the monitor tracks your performance, including distance, time, calories burned, and stroke rate.
Water Rower: WaterRower Classic
The WaterRower Classic is a favorite among those seeking a realistic rowing experience. The water resistance system is whisper-quiet and provides a smooth, natural rowing motion. The machine is well-built, with a solid frame and a comfortable seat. The S4 monitor tracks your workout data, allowing you to monitor your progress over time.
Magnetic Rower: Stamina InMotion Rower
The Stamina InMotion Rower is an excellent choice for those on a budget. It offers a compact design, easy storage, and a comfortable rowing experience. The magnetic resistance system is quiet and provides a smooth workout. The monitor tracks basic workout data, including time, strokes, and calories burned.
Expert Tips for Your Home Workout Setup
Choosing the Right Rowing Machine
- Consider Your Space: Measure the area where you plan to place the rowing machine to ensure it fits comfortably.
- Budget: Determine your budget and research machines within that price range.
- Fitness Goals: Choose a machine that aligns with your fitness goals, whether it’s weight loss, muscle building, or cardiovascular health.
- Comfort: Look for a machine with a comfortable seat and adjustable foot straps.
Setting Up Your Rowing Machine
- Unboxing and Assembly: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for unboxing and assembly. If you’re not comfortable assembling it yourself, consider hiring a professional.
- Safety Check: Ensure all parts are secure and the machine is stable before use.
- Proper Form: Learn proper rowing form to prevent injury and maximize your workout.
Maintaining Your Rowing Machine
-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the machine after each use to prevent the buildup of sweat and dirt.
- Lubrication: Follow the manufacturer’s recommendations for lubricating moving parts.
- Tension Adjustment: Check and adjust the tension as needed to maintain a consistent resistance.
Maximizing Your Workout
- Warm-Up: Begin each workout with a 5-10 minute warm-up to prepare your muscles and joints.
- Interval Training: Incorporate interval training into your routine to increase calorie burn and improve cardiovascular fitness.
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water before, during, and after your workout.
